A protection system of ship's power distribution system, when a fault occurs in the feeder preset to be in charge of the third circuit breaker module, the relay of the third circuit breaker module trips the circuit breaker based on a magnitude and a direction of a fault current, and to transmit a power distribution maintenance signal to the relay of the second circuit breaker module. When a fault occurs in the switchboard preset to be in charge of the second circuit breaker module, the relays of the second and third circuit breaker modules trip the circuit breaker based on a magnitude and a direction of a fault current and the relay of the second circuit breaker module transmit a power distribution maintenance signal to the relay of the third circuit breaker module preset based on the magnitude and direction of the fault current.
